EDITORS COMMENTS
This print showcases the vibrant beauty of a Red-necked phalarope, Phalaropus lobatus (Phalaropus hyperboreus). The image is a handcoloured copperplate drawn and engraved by John Latham, featured in his renowned work "A General History of Birds" published in Winchester in 1824. The Red-necked phalarope gracefully poses against a backdrop that highlights its stunning plumage. Its reddish neck stands out prominently, contrasting with the bird's delicate white feathers and intricate patterns on its wings. The artist's attention to detail is evident as every stroke captures the essence of this remarkable creature. Latham's expertise in ornithology shines through this engraving, showcasing his deep understanding and appreciation for birds. His work not only serves as an artistic masterpiece but also contributes to scientific knowledge about these fascinating creatures. This piece transports us back to the 19th century when natural history illustrations were highly valued for their accuracy and aesthetic appeal.
